Argentina professors gather for workshop

Professors from the Argentina Central District gathered September 3 for workshops about teaching theology courses in the associate's degree program. The 30 attending professors are in charge of teaching classes at Southern Cone Nazarene Theological Seminary's main campus and accredited centers.

NCN (Nazarene Communications Network) is the official news service for the Church of the Nazarene denomination. Founded in 1958, it was originally known as Nazarene Information Services.
